Early Life and Education
Born on July 9, 1947, in San Francisco, California, OJ Simpson’s family struggled with poverty, and he spent most of his childhood growing up in a sketchy area. He then went on to attend Galileo High School and later graduated from City College of San Francisco. His excellence in football granted him a full scholarship to the University of Southern California, where he led the Trojans to an NCAA championship in 1967.
Career
In 1969, OJ Simpson was drafted by the Buffalo Bills in the NFL, where he spent his entire football career until 1979. Throughout his career, he played running back and was a significant force behind the Bills’ emergence as a top team in the National Football League. He was awarded the NFL’s leading player and MVP accolades in 1973 and was inducted into the Pro Football Hall of Fame in 1985.
After retiring from football, OJ Simpson pursued various roles in the entertainment business, including acting, commentary, and advertising. He also appeared in several notable movies, including “The Naked Gun” series, “Capricorn One,” “Cops and Robbersons,” and “Back to the Beach.”
Personal Life
OJ Simpson has been married two times, the first in 1967 to Marguerite Whitley. They had three children together before finalizing their divorce in 1979. In 1985, he married Nicole Brown Simpson, and they had two children together. Unfortunately, their marriage was marred by abuse and ended in divorce in 1992. Sadly, Nicole and her friend, Ron Goldman, were brutally murdered in 1994, and OJ was arrested and tried for their deaths.
After a highly publicized trial that lasted over a year, he was acquitted of criminal charges, but the families of the victims won a civil suit of $33.5 million against him. In 2007, he was found guilty of an unrelated crime and sentenced to 33 years in prison, with the possibility of parole after nine years. He was released in 2017.

Legacy
Regardless of his achievements in the football and entertainment industries, OJ Simpson’s legacy is primarily defined by the horrific white Bronco chase and his murder trial. The two events have overshadowed his impressive career highlights and have left a cloud of mystery and controversy surrounding his persona.
